Chris Schultz Selected as a “Go To Lawyer” in Business Law
CMDA is proud to announce that Christopher G. Schultz has been recognized as a “Go To Lawyer” for Business Law by Michigan Lawyers Weekly. The “Go To Lawyers” program identifies and recognizes the top 22 lawyers across the state in a given practice area.
Christopher G. Schultz has broad and extensive experience of nearly 40 years in matters involving small and large businesses and related litigation. He has significantly grown the Firm’s Business Law practice group over the years by bringing in many new clients to the Firm, including manufacturers, financial service institutions, and small and large businesses in the retail and service sectors.
His primary focus is on entity selection, start-up and funding issues, shareholder and owner relationships, employment matters, mergers, acquisitions, real estate matters, and business succession planning. Additionally, he assists clients with estate planning matters, including wills, trusts, charitable giving, estate administration, irrevocable trusts, gifting and special needs trusts.
Mr. Schultz joined CMDA in 1993, has served as the managing partner of the Firm since 2013, and was named an equity partner in 2019.
